THE SCHOOLHOUSE BAKEHOUSE, family friendly in Bishop's Castle
This ground floor apartment in Bishop's Castle sleeps four people in two bedrooms.
The School Bakehouse Apartment is an all ground floor cottage apartment in the market town of Bishop's Castle. This apartment sleeps four people in two bedrooms, consisting of one double with en-suite bathroom and a twin room, as well as a shower room. The cottage also has an open plan living area with kitchen, dining area and sitting area with woodburning stove. Outside there is a front, private patio with furniture, a shared tennis court and off road parking for two cars. The School Bakehouse Apartment is an ideal base for exploring the many attractions in the area, including the World Heritage Site of Ironbridge Gorge, Ludlow and Shrewsbury.
Amenities: Oil fired underfloor central heating with woodburning stove in sitting area. Electric oven and hob, microwave, slow cooker, fridge, use of washing machine in shared utility, 3 x TVs with Freeview, DVDs, CD, iPod docks, WiFi. Fuel, power and starter pack for woodburning stove in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Cot and highchair. Off road parking for 2 cars. Front private patio with furniture. Shared use of all year round tennis court. Sorry, no pets and no smoking. Town shops and amenities 5 mins walk. Award-winning real ale pub/restaurant 1 min walk.
Region: A E Houseman once wrote that Shropshire was “the quietest place under the sun” and today the county remains something of a rural idyll, recognised as one of the least crowded and most peaceful regions in England.
Town: The market town of Bishop's Castle boasts a weekly market and a good variety of shops, pubs and restaurants. Walks and cycle routes are nearby, as is the towns of Ludlow and Shrewsbury.
